If I connect an external screen to the iPad via the HDMI adapter, iGigbook stops responding to the Airturn BT-105 pedal.
If I just use the iPad, then the pedal works fine and turn pages as it should.
I want to connect an external screen in order to view two pages side by side on a larger screen.
The pages show up just fine, but then the iGigbook stops responding to the Airturn.
If I disconnect the external screen again, iGigbook still won't respond to the pedal until I exit the Set, and open the Set again in Set Viewer.
I am using version 2.0
Is this a bug, or am I overlooking something here?
